1. AI in DevOps
AI and machine learning are fundamentally shifting how DevOps operates. Traditionally, DevOps focused on collaboration, automation, and CI/CD pipelines. Now, with AI, systems can self-heal, predict incidents, and even optimize code deployments.
AI in DevOps helps in:
- Real-time monitoring and anomaly detection
- Predictive analytics for downtime prevention
- Automating manual tasks
- Enhancing security with threat detection

3. Top AI-Powered DevOps Tools in 2025
Here’s a brief overview of top tools making waves:
1. Harness
Website: https://harness.io
AI-powered CD platform that automates deployment verification.
2. Dynatrace
Website: https://www.dynatrace.com
Offers AI-driven monitoring and observability.
3. Moogsoft
Website: https://www.moogsoft.com
AI for incident detection and response automation.
4. IBM Watson AIOps
Website: https://www.ibm.com/cloud/watson-aiops
AI platform to manage and predict IT operations anomalies.

6. Cost and Licensing Breakdown
Platform | Open Source | License Type | Starting Cost |
Harness | ❌ | Commercial | Custom pricing |
Dynatrace | ❌ | Commercial | $21/month per 8 GB |
Moogsoft | ❌ | Commercial | Contact for quote |
IBM Watson | ❌ | Commercial | Starts at $200/month |
7. Programming Languages and Tech Stack
Tool | Backend Languages Used | AI/ML Stack |
Harness | Java, Go | Proprietary AI models |
Dynatrace | Java, Node.js, Python | Davis AI |
Moogsoft | Node.js, Python | NLP, clustering algorithms |
IBM Watson | Java, Python, Scala | Watson NLP, ML, Deep Learning |
